Hi all,

Quick note ahead of the leadership call. The margin review for Orvetta Goods wrapped last week, and the short version: we're two points under plan, mostly freight and the Kestrel product line's packaging costs. Branch managers, please pull your local cost sheets before Thursday so we can compare apples to apples. Nobody's in trouble — we just need clean numbers to decide where to trim. Expect a few pointed questions on supplier contracts. The confidential planning note is included below.

Cheers,
Marten

internal memo for kawip-hadug: Headcount on the Wenwyn team goes from 7 to 140 by the end of January. Gross margin on Wenwyn came in at 20 percent against a plan of 15 percent.

Step 4: Retrying failed exports. After cutover to Driftline v3, any exports stuck in FAILED must be requeued manually; the old auto-retry daemon is gone. Use the requeue CLI with the batch flag, max 200 per run. Do not touch PENDING rows. Before requeuing, confirm the worker pool matches the following configuration values.

settings of fafog-haduf:
ZORIX_PIN=4648
ZORIX_METRICS_HOST=metrics.zorix.paliqsys.corp
ZORIX_LOG_LEVEL=info
ZORIX_TENANT=druix

MEMO — Finance Team
Re: Launch plan, Quillon Fieldkit

Launch date confirmed: March 4. Budget locked at the figure approved in January; no contingency draw expected. Initial production run of 40,000 units from the Estbrook facility. Channel margin set at 22%. Revenue recognition begins on shipment, per the Tarveth policy memo. Payback modeled at 11 months. Flag any variance above 5% immediately. The confidential planning note follows directly below.

board note of kageg-bahof: The renewal with Holwynax Holdings closes at $2 million a year, 5 percent below the last contract. Project Ulaath slips by two quarters because of the supplier delay.

**Action item (canary gating):** Plugin authors on Flintwick's Driftgate platform kept tripping the canary gate because our error-budget thresholds were tuned for first-party traffic. Going forward, plugins get a separate gating profile with looser latency windows but stricter crash-rate cutoffs. If your plugin fails a canary, check these values before filing a ticket. The constants the gate currently enforces are listed below.

tuning table, faduf-baduf:
PRIORITIES = {
    "ulavan": 191,
    "silys": 750,
    "goriel": 238,
    "kelmir": 66,
    "wendor": 432,
}